Sony Music Publishing Debuts Lavish New Hollywood Offices: “A Disneyland for Songwriters”

Hollywood’s Sycamore media district, as the area east of La Brea Ave. and south of Santa Monica Blvd. is called, is becoming a hub of music publishing, with such companies as Roc Nation, Kobalt Music and Sony Music Publishing opening flagship offices there.

Sony is the latest to arrive and hosted its official opening with a Thursday night party that drew music industry tastemakers, creatives and key executives pushing the company — home to songs by Beyonce, the Beatles, Ed Sheeran and Leonard Cohen, among hundreds more — to become market share leader under chairman and CEO Jon Platt.

The veteran executive, who started out as a DJ in Denver and went on to top positions at EMI Music Publishing and Warner Chappell Music (where he signed Beyonce and Jay-Z), before taking the reins at SMP in 2019, truly created an office in his image. The space is warm and inviting, with neutral tones carrying from room-to-room in what’s intended to function as an office space and hub for affiliated music makers. Adorning the walls, you won’t find many of the passé gold and platinum records, the roster’s impressive and storied past is on display in the form of life-sized photographs and other art.

In announcing the new address, conveniently located around the corner from Beyonce’s Parkwood Entertainment business and Jay-Z investment vehicle Mr. T’s, SMP described it as a testament to its “commitment to fostering creativity and collaboration.”

Said Platt: “Our aim was to build a space that supports songwriters every step of the way, welcomes creators, and supports their needs.”

A staffer at the Thursday party said the goal was to create “a Disneyland for songwriters.”

SMP’s new Hollywood customized office space is situated in a reimagined century-old building, designed through a collaboration with architects WSDG and design firm RIOS.

The space has five dedicated studios, six listening rooms, a recording studio with two recording booths and an artist lounge. SMP said in a release that the suites are situated alongside office and social areas to continue promoting engagement between staff and creators. It also boasts Dolby Atmos capabilities.

SMP has recently developed and enhanced spaces around the world including Nashville, the U.K., Germany and Canada.
